Elon Musk aims to transform X into a multi-purpose app, drawing inspiration from China’s WeChat, where users can socialise and manage finances.
“Early version of video and audio calling on X,” Musk wrote in a post that contained a screen capture showing how to turn the feature on in the platform’s settings. However, multiple users responded to Musk’s post saying they did not see the feature in their app, which was also not visible in a version tested by AFP.
The calling features would work on iOS, Android, Mac and PC systems, and no phone number would be needed, he said at the time.Musk in July rebranded Twitter as X, saying it would become an “everything app” inspired by China’s WeChat that would allow users to socialise as well as handle their finances.
